Australian Treasurer Expects to See Progress in Inflation Fight

In a recent statement, the Australian Treasurer expressed optimism about the country's efforts to combat inflation. This announcement is significant not only for the Australian economy but also for global financial markets. Understanding the potential short-term and long-term impacts of such news is crucial for investors and analysts alike.

Short-term Impacts

1. Market Reactions:

  • Australian Dollar (AUD): Positive news on inflation control may lead to an appreciation of the Australian dollar. Investors might see this as a sign of economic stability and growth, prompting them to invest in AUD-denominated assets.
  • ASX 200 Index (ASX: XJO): The Australian stock market, particularly the ASX 200, could experience a bullish trend as investors react positively to the Treasurer's comments. Sectors sensitive to inflation, such as consumer staples and financials, may see increased activity.

2. Bond Markets:

  • Government Bonds: If inflation is perceived to be under control, yields on Australian government bonds may decline as investors anticipate a stable interest rate environment. This could enhance the attractiveness of existing bonds.

3. Futures and Commodities:

  • Commodity Prices: As Australia is a significant exporter of commodities, any positive outlook on inflation could lead to an uptick in commodity prices, especially for resources such as iron ore and coal.

Long-term Impacts

1. Monetary Policy Adjustments:

  • The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A) may adjust its monetary policy in response to any progress in inflation control. If inflation shows signs of consistent decline, the RBA may consider lowering interest rates in the long term, which could further stimulate economic growth.

2. Investor Confidence:

  • A sustained effort in fighting inflation could lead to increased confidence among local and international investors. This could result in more foreign direct investment (FDI) into Australia, benefiting sectors such as real estate and infrastructure.

3. Economic Growth:

  • If inflation continues to be managed effectively, Australia could see a more stable economic environment, leading to robust growth prospects. This could positively impact the ASX over the long term, boosting corporate earnings and stock valuations.

Historical Context

Looking back, similar announcements have occurred in the past, notably during the 1990s when Australia faced high inflation rates. For instance, in June 1993, the then Treasurer noted progress in inflation control, resulting in a short-term rally in the ASX 200 and a strengthening of the Australian dollar. The long-term effects included a period of stable economic growth and favorable investment conditions.
